Design for Visualized Presentation of Microcosmic Chemical Reaction Process Based on Matlab GUI

Abstract:Based on the quasi-classical trajectory (QCT) method and Matlab GUI technology, we developed a program code for visualizing the collision process of the elementary chemical reactions of the a + bc type. The general methodology of QCT, abstraction of dynamical properties of molecular collisions and the making of Graphical User Interface are introduced. The running results of an application to the reaction F + HCl→HF + Cl is also presented. The results showed that this program could vividly demonstrate the behavior and final state of the atom-diatom collision process in animated form. Students can interact with internal MATLAB code through graphical user interface, observe the reactive behavior and final results in real-time from multiple angles, which helps students to understand the complex reaction mechanism and deepen their perceptual impression of the chemical process at a microscopic atomic/molecular level.
